Transaction 7af03236c27597639cf2c06426cc0daff2540fe60734df6be2f69ea7713e9190

1 Input
2 Outputs
  • 7af03236c27597639cf2c06426cc0daff2540fe60734df6be2f69ea7713e9190:0
  • value  1270491875
    address  3MG31oSS4YTFHZoREghumTV84ggtsizTbg
  • 7af03236c27597639cf2c06426cc0daff2540fe60734df6be2f69ea7713e9190:1
  • value  57020000
    address  3HrimcUrh8vRKCu9j5eNv2BqaUzn5B7Pzc